Subject: Tidewisp widget cut-over done

Heads up: the Tidewisp tide-table widget is now serving from the new Harrowgate endpoint as of 02:00. Legacy endpoint is in read-only fallback for 48 hours, then gone. Cache warm-up finished; latency looks normal.

If the widget shows stale predictions, restart the forecast poller first — that fixed both staging incidents. Escalate to the Marden team only if tables go blank.

The live configuration values are included below for reference.

deployment values, yadug-bawif:
[framir]
team = pelox
access_code = ac_a38ab2
owner = tamion.julael
host = framir.tolvaqlabs.test
port = 11211
peer = tammir.zemvargrid.local
salt = 2215ef03
pin = 1541

Ticket #— Floor 9 Opening Prep, Brindlemoor House

Hi facilities folks, Floor 9 opens to staff next Monday and we need a few things squared away before then. Lift access is live, but the two side doors by the kitchenette are still on the old lock config — please reprogram them before Friday. Also, signage for the quiet rooms hasn't arrived, so pop up the temporary printed ones for now. Until the badge readers sync, the interim door code for Floor 9 is below.

door code, bajop-bajog: bdg-DSWAC-43621

### Capacity note: Quillbox puzzle generation

Quillbox's generator is CPU-bound during grid fill, and peak demand arrives in bursts when the Sunday batch kicks off. At current wordlist size, each 15x15 fill averages 2.1s with a long tail near 30s on sparse themes. We propose capping concurrent fills per worker and queueing overflow rather than scaling pods reactively. The proposed limits and queue bounds are listed below.

tuning table, yajog-faduf:
QUOTAS = {
    "briir": 907,
    "novys": 314,
    "holius": 831,
    "jorir": 657,
    "zorys": 972,
}